Reading Area Community College

Reading Area Community College (referred to as RACC) is a Public, 2-4 years school located in Reading, PA. It is classified as Associate's - Public Suburban-serving Multicampus school by Carnegie Classification and its highest level of offering is Associate's degree.
The 2023 tuition & fees at Reading Area Community College is $10,890 for Pennsylvania residents and $12,030 for out-of-state students. The school has a total enrollment of 4,533 and students to faculty ratio is 5.26% (19 to 1).

Who Accredits Reading Area Community College

Reading Area Community College is accredited by Middle States Commission on Higher Education (1/1/1979 - Current).

The undergraduate tuition & fees at RACC is $10,890 for Pennsylvania residents and $12,030 for out-of-state students for the academic year 2022-2023.
RACC offers the alternative tuition plans. 99% of enrolled students have received grants and/or scholarships and the average amount of received financial aid is $3,524 (exclude student loans).

RACC offers the distance education programs that all courses for completing a degree program can be done through online exclusively for undergraduate programs. In addition, the distance learning courses are offered for students who are not enrolled online exclusively.
RACC offers teacher certification program.
